mount
命令通常用于挂载文件系统,但也可以用于挂载加密设备
- 首先,确保你已经安装了
cryptsetup
和mount.cifs
(如果你使用的是 CIFS 协议)。在基于 Debian 的系统上,可以使用以下命令安装:
sudo apt-get install cryptsetup cifs-utils
在基于 RHEL 的系统上,可以使用以下命令安装:
sudo yum install cryptsetup cifs-utils
- 创建一个加密卷。例如,创建一个名为
my_encrypted_volume
的 LUKS 加密卷:
sudo cryptsetup luksFormat /dev/sdXN
将 /dev/sdXN
替换为你要加密的设备的路径。系统会提示你输入加密密码。
- 打开加密卷:
sudo cryptsetup open /dev/sdXN my_encrypted_volume
将 /dev/sdXN
替换为你要加密的设备的路径,将 my_encrypted_volume
替换为你为该卷分配的名称。
- 获取加密卷的设备路径。运行以下命令:
sudo lsblk -f
找到加密卷的设备路径,例如 /dev/mapper/my_encrypted_volume
。
- 创建一个挂载点,例如
/mnt/my_encrypted_volume
:
sudo mkdir /mnt/my_encrypted_volume
- 挂载加密卷到挂载点:
sudo mount -t cifs //server_ip/share /mnt/my_encrypted_volume -o username=username,password=password,domain=domain
将 //server_ip/share
替换为 CIFS 服务器的共享路径,将 username
、password
和 domain
替换为实际的用户名、密码和域名。
现在,你可以访问 /mnt/my_encrypted_volume
来访问加密设备上的文件。
当你完成对加密设备的操作后,可以使用以下命令卸载它:
sudo umount /mnt/my_encrypted_volume